God Sees Me as Wonderfully Made

God is the Creator of all things, including you. He knit you together in your mother’s womb and made you with purpose. You are not an accident or a mistake. Your existence is intentional, and your life has value beyond measure. God doesn’t make worthless things—He delights in His creation, including you. When you’re tempted to feel less than enough, remember that your identity begins with being fearfully and wonderfully made by God.

Psalm 139:14

“Thank you for making me so wonderfully complex! Your workmanship is marvelous—how well I know it.”

Jeremiah 1:5

“I knew you before I formed you in your mother’s womb. Before you were born I set you apart and appointed you as my prophet to the nations.”

Job 10:8-9

“You formed me with your hands; you made me. …Remember that you made me from dust—will you turn me back to dust so soon?”

Isaiah 64:8

“And yet, O Lord, you are our Father. We are the clay, and you are the potter. We all are formed by your hand.”

Genesis 1:27

“So God created human beings in his own image. In the image of God he created them; male and female he created them.”

God Loves Me Unconditionally

God’s love is not based on your performance or perfection—His love is eternal and unchanging. He chose to love you even while you were still a sinner. This love is so deep and powerful that nothing in creation can separate you from it. Understanding God’s unconditional love gives you confidence, peace, and freedom to walk in His truth and grace.

Romans 5:8

“But God showed his great love for us by sending Christ to die for us while we were still sinners.”

Romans 8:38-39

“And I am convinced that nothing can ever separate us from God’s love… indeed, nothing in all creation will ever be able to separate us from the love of God.”

John 3:16

“For this is how God loved the world: He gave his one and only Son, so that everyone who believes in him will not perish but have eternal life.”

1 John 4:10

“This is real love—not that we loved God, but that he loved us and sent his Son as a sacrifice to take away our sins.”

Zephaniah 3:17

“For the Lord your God is living among you. He is a mighty savior. He will take delight in you with gladness.”

God Calls Me His Child

Through faith in Jesus Christ, you are adopted into God’s family. He is not just your Creator; He is your Father. This divine relationship comes with love, inheritance, guidance, and protection. You are not alone or abandoned—you are God’s beloved child, and He is always present and active in your life as a good Father.

John 1:12

“But to all who believed him and accepted him, he gave the right to become children of God.”

Galatians 3:26

“For you are all children of God through faith in Christ Jesus.”

Romans 8:15

“So you have not received a spirit that makes you fearful slaves. Instead, you received God’s Spirit when he adopted you as his own children.”

1 John 3:1

“See how very much our Father loves us, for he calls us his children, and that is what we are!”

Matthew 7:11

“So if you sinful people know how to give good gifts to your children, how much more will your heavenly Father give good gifts to those who ask him.”

God Thinks Good Thoughts Toward Me

God’s plans and thoughts toward you are filled with hope, peace, and a future. He is not waiting to punish or condemn you—He desires good things for you. Even when life feels uncertain, you can rest knowing God is intentional about your life, and His plans are rooted in His perfect love and wisdom.

Jeremiah 29:11

“For I know the plans I have for you,” says the Lord. “They are plans for good and not for disaster, to give you a future and a hope.”

Psalm 40:5

“O Lord my God, you have performed many wonders for us. Your plans for us are too numerous to list.”

Psalm 139:17

“How precious are your thoughts about me, O God. They cannot be numbered!”

Isaiah 55:9

“For just as the heavens are higher than the earth, so my ways are higher than your ways and my thoughts higher than your thoughts.”

Proverbs 16:3

“Commit your actions to the Lord, and your plans will succeed.”

God Sees Me Through Christ

When God looks at you, He sees the righteousness of Christ, not your past mistakes. Through Jesus, you are justified, redeemed, and made new. Your identity is rooted not in what you’ve done, but in what Jesus has done for you. This truth gives you the boldness to approach God and live a life worthy of His calling.

2 Corinthians 5:17

“This means that anyone who belongs to Christ has become a new person. The old life is gone; a new life has begun!”

2 Corinthians 5:21

“For God made Christ, who never sinned, to be the offering for our sin, so that we could be made right with God through Christ.”

Romans 8:1

“So now there is no condemnation for those who belong to Christ Jesus.”

Colossians 1:22

“Yet now he has reconciled you to himself through the death of Christ in his physical body. …you are holy and blameless as you stand before him without a single fault.”

Galatians 2:20

“My old self has been crucified with Christ. …I live in this earthly body by trusting in the Son of God, who loved me and gave himself for me.”

God Desires a Close Relationship With Me

God doesn’t want a distant, ritual-based connection with you—He desires deep fellowship, closeness, and love. He invites you to draw near, speak to Him, and walk with Him daily. He listens, speaks, and cares about every detail of your life. You are never too far for Him to reach, and He wants to be close to you.

James 4:8

“Come close to God, and God will come close to you.”

Revelation 3:20

“Look! I stand at the door and knock. If you hear my voice and open the door, I will come in, and we will share a meal together as friends.”

Psalm 145:18

“The Lord is close to all who call on him, yes, to all who call on him in truth.”

John 15:15

“I no longer call you slaves… Now you are my friends, since I have told you everything the Father told me.”

Isaiah 41:10

“Don’t be afraid, for I am with you. Don’t be discouraged, for I am your God.”

God Has a Purpose for Me

Your life is not random or meaningless. God has a unique purpose for you—a divine assignment that fits who you are in Him. He equips you with gifts, passions, and opportunities to serve His kingdom. You were created on purpose, with purpose, and for a purpose. Trust that your journey is part of a bigger picture designed by God.

Ephesians 2:10

“For we are God’s masterpiece. He has created us anew in Christ Jesus, so we can do the good things he planned for us long ago.”

Romans 12:6

“In his grace, God has given us different gifts for doing certain things well.”

Philippians 2:13

“For God is working in you, giving you the desire and the power to do what pleases him.”

Proverbs 19:21

“You can make many plans, but the Lord’s purpose will prevail.”

Isaiah 46:10

“Only I can tell you the future before it even happens. Everything I plan will come to pass, for I do whatever I wish.”
